Siddharth Kiara's love life
Let us tell you that Siddharth Malhotra and Kiara Advani got married on 7 February 2023. Both of them got married in Rajasthan. Before marriage, the couple had dated each other for a long time. After two years of marriage, the couple announced pregnancy on 28 February 2025. Both wrote in their social media post that the biggest gift of their life is about to come.
